April is the Month of the Military Child! Every year we take the opportunity to recognize military-connected youth for their service and contribution to our community. Fairfax County Public Schools is proud to have over 14,000 military-connected youth as a part of our student body. We appreciate the varied life experiences they bring to our school community, and recognize their strength and resilience. 

To show our support, we are inviting all Fairfax County students, families, school employees, and community members to “Purple Up!” on April 20 for military children. 

Why purple? Purple symbolizes all branches of the military as a combination of Army green, Marine Corps red, and Coast Guard, Navy, Air Force, and Space Force blue.

FanQuest Rescheduled for April 30th!

FanQuest has been rescheduled to Saturday, April 30th at Woodson HS.  Come out and watch Woodson’s Special Olympics Unified Basketball team play Robinson Secondary School! 

Unified is a model of Special Olympics where student athletes with disabilities and their same-aged peers play alongside one another on one unified team. This differs from Special Olympics because that model only has athletes with disabilities. With the support from our Woodson Buddies and Partnership class, Woodson HS has a strong Unified team and we participate in Soccer, Basketball and Track and Field. FanQuest is the culminating event for both Special Olympics and Unified Basketball.


2022 Regional Scholastic Writing Awards

The Scholastic Art and Writing Awards, presented by the Alliance for Young Artists and Writers, is the largest, longest-running recognition program of its kind in the United States. Writing categories include critical essay, dramatic script, flash fiction, humor, journalism, novel writing, personal essay and memoir, poetry, science fiction and fantasy, short story, and writing portfolio. The Marching Cavaliers will be holding tryouts for the fall 2022 marching season color guard. Not sure what color guard is? Well the color guard is open to any student grades 9-12 and is an auxiliary unit in the marching band that adds color, pageantry and general effect to the show. All members are held to the same standards and expectations as the band students and are considered a part of the band. Check out our website for more details HERE

AP Exam Change

Change in Observance Day

At the time the FCPS calendar was developed, local Eid observances were expected to occur on May 3rd, but because local Eid observances shifted to May 2nd, the FCPS Employee Newsletter on February 8th announced a change in the Religious and Cultural Observance day in FCPS for Eid-al-Fitr from May 3rd to May 2nd, 2022.

Altered AP Exam Schedule

After careful consideration, FCPS leadership decided to continue with the established AP exam schedule for May 2, 2022. May 3rd exams that were previously rescheduled for May 17th will remain on May 17th.

Northern Virginia Community College Offering Free Classes for Graduating Seniors

Qualified seniors graduating this spring who are considering attending Northern Virginia Community College (NOVA) may take one 3-credit course and NOVA’s 1-credit College Success Skills course, SDV 100 (at no cost) as part of the JumpStart2NOVA program. Since these classes are all online, students will need access to a computer and the Internet.

The application is open now and will close at 5 p.m. on April 29. All students will be required to upload a high school transcript and any qualifying test scores if they do not have a 3.0 grade point average. Courses begin May 31 and end August 8.
